There are a variety of things that can impact the expense of your specific above ground swimming pool elimination. Size of the swimming pool. Location and availability of the pool. Did you see this? of products being gotten rid of (swimming pool material, stairs, deck, fence, landscaping, and so on) Whether or not the swimming pool needs to be emptied. Who you employ.
The more product you need to eliminate, the more your total task expense will be. Likewise, the larger your above ground pool, the more it will cost to eliminate it. If your pool is still filled with water, it will be another charge to securely drain it and get it prepared for removal.

Get Pumping The primary step in destroying an above ground pool is to pump it out! Usually, the simplest method to do this is to rent a trash pump from a rental company. We recommend renting a 3 trash pump, as smaller sized pumps take tremendously longer to pump out a pool.
It is crucial to keep in mind where you are draining pipes the pool water to, as swimming pools hold countless gallons of water and can easily flood a street or next-door neighbor's yard! Keep in mind that when running a garbage pump that you must prime the pump with water in order to get it pumping.
